All five Armenian citizens, who are presently in Cairo, are students. They were not hurt in unrests, spokesperson for the Armenian foreign office Tigran Balayan told Armenian News-NEWS.am.
“Armenian Embassy in Egypt is in contact with them. The foreign ministry is in touch with the Armenian Ambassador in Cairo. As to the local Armenian community, they do not interfere and bear no relation to riots. In any case the Armenian community was not affected,” he said.
Summing up, the spokesperson noted the building of the Armenian Embassy is in a safe place and is well protected.
Yesterday Egypt’s president Hosni Mubarak announced he dismissed the Cabinet and intends to form a new one today.
